user104658 04-06-2022 11:05 AM

I mean... some of those comments are clearly racist. I also don't think you can call the casting of a new role a "diversity hire" without it being somewhat racist. Recasting a role/retconning a character, yes I can see the issue, but a brand new character? Suggesting that they "should be white" and anything else is a diversity casting is clearly racist.

Whether or not the level is newsworthy depends on the proportion of people making those sorts of comments; stamping out trolling entirely is an unachievable goal and sometimes shining a spotlight on the accounts doing it has the opposite effect, and it serves as a beacon to other like-minded people to join in.
